From c1dc5b0b06a77bf32006dbb0ebcdf73872479b88 Mon Sep 17 00:00:00 2001 From: Lars Toenning Date: Tue, 31 Jan 2023 22:00:14 +0100 Subject: [PATCH] Add icon and tooltips to plugin selector --- src/blackgui/pluginselector.cpp |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/blackgui/pluginselector.cpp b/src/blackgui/pluginselector.cpp index 02f63dc41..aaa8f54dc 100644 --- a/src/blackgui/pluginselector.cpp +++ b/src/blackgui/pluginselector.cpp @@ -7,6 +7,7 @@ */ #include "blackgui/pluginselector.h" +#include "blackmisc/icons.h" #include "blackmisc/verify.h" #include @@ -59,13 +60,15 @@ namespace BlackGui if (hasConfig) { - QPushButton *config = new QPushButton("..."); + QPushButton *config = new QPushButton(BlackMisc::CIcons::wrench16(), ""); + config->setToolTip("Plugin configuration"); m_configButtonMapper->setMapping(config, identifier); connect(config, &QPushButton::clicked, m_configButtonMapper, qOverload<>(&QSignalMapper::map)); pw->layout()->addWidget(config); } QPushButton *details = new QPushButton("?"); + details->setToolTip("Plugin details"); m_detailsButtonMapper->setMapping(details, identifier); connect(details, &QPushButton::clicked, m_detailsButtonMapper, qOverload<>(&QSignalMapper::map)); pw->layout()->addWidget(details);